AP® Score Hider
You spend hundreds of hours in classes and even more doing homework, yet your reward for taking an AP® Exam is a single digit. Even worse, once you go to your scores page it shows them all at once, which is very anticlimactic. Introducing AP® Score Hider. With this extension, all of your exam scores are hidden until you click on the box containing the score. If you get a 3, 4, or 5, confetti blasts off. The higher the score, the more confetti.

📜 Installation
- Install Tampermonkey from the Chrome Web Store (or [Firefox
- Go to the GreasyFork page (you're probably already here) and click the green "Install this script" button. This will take you to a page on Tampermonkey where you need to click "Install" to install the script.
🚫 Uninstallation
If you don't want to use this script anymore, you can uninstall it anytime.
- Navigate to the Tampermonkey dashboard (click the extension icon in the top right, then click "Dashboard" at the bottom of the popup)
- Click the trashcan on the right side of the page
